Output 21d4aa34f30b36140914c7d3b7389b5c592fa86d4efa0af734ff33d865a6230a:1

value
19918336
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4626ba5ac6c3d47f0c78e590813871bb11ac3589 OP_EQUALVERIFY OP_CHECKSIG
address
17PvhJ11N9wYEhst3Zdpodop2b8ncw3Lya
transaction
21d4aa34f30b36140914c7d3b7389b5c592fa86d4efa0af734ff33d865a6230a
spent
true